Trionychid的意思、翻譯和例句

是什麼意思

「Trionychid」指的是軟殼龜科(Trionychidae),這是一類主要棲息於淡水環境的龜類,特徵是其柔軟的龜殼和長長的頸部。這些龜類通常在水中生活,並以水生植物和小動物為食。軟殼龜在世界各地的河流、湖泊和沼澤中都有分佈,特別是在熱帶和亞熱帶地區。
